Common Tree Removal Scenarios
A dead tree is one that has lost its living tissue and structural strength, and on a Tigard property it’s a fall risk as it decays and spreads pests.
A dead tree near a home can cause damage if it fails in a storm.
Tigard generally doesn’t require a permit to remove residential trees, so dead-tree removal is usually straightforward unless the tree is a heritage or sensitive-lands tree, which Monkeyman’s checks first.
An overgrown tree is a healthy tree that has outgrown its space, threatening structures near Fanno Creek and beyond.
The owner is responsible for safe removal when a tree endangers property.
Monkeyman’s handles overgrown removals and checks whether the tree falls under any regulated category before any work.
A diseased tree carries an infection that weakens it from within. The Fanno Creek corridor’s humidity fosters root rot, heart rot, and Verticillium wilt.
These infections are hard to detect early and can spread.
Monkeyman’s ISA Certified Arborists diagnose, contain spread, and remove trees that can’t be saved.
A storm-damaged tree has been cracked, split, or uprooted by wind, ice, or debris. Storm damage is common in Tigard.
More than 50% crown loss usually means removal, though resilient trees often survive.
Monkeyman’s evaluates whether a tree can recover before recommending removal.
Emergency tree removal is the 24/7 response needed when a tree has fallen, or threatens to, onto a home, vehicle, or power line.
For hazardous removals, Monkeyman’s uses crane support through Smith Crane.
When a tree falls on your Tigard property, we respond day or night.
View clearing is the selective removal or pruning of trees that block a scenic sightline. Some elevated Tigard properties (such as Bull Mountain) have views worth opening.
The work opens the sightline while respecting any sensitive-lands rules.
Monkeyman’s selectively clears blocking trees while preserving your canopy.
Lot clearing is the systematic removal of trees and brush to prepare a site for building. Tigard development must account for sensitive-lands and development-required trees.
Sectional removal and heavy equipment are used as needed.
Monkeyman’s clears residential and commercial lots and checks regulated-tree status first.

The cost of a tree removal can vary based on several factors, including the size and species of the tree, its condition, location, and accessibility. We also consider what’s surrounding the tree – such as structures, landscaping, or utilities – that may require protection and more advanced rigging techniques or specialized equipment.
Because every project is unique, we perform on-site inspections before providing an estimate. This allows us to deliver pricing that is accurate, transparent, and tailored to the specific scope of work.
An 80ft tree sandwiched between two homes on a cliff side containing 18 bees nests is going to cost a bit more than a 10ft apple tree in the middle of a field (and no bee nests).
The time it takes to remove a tree depends on many of the same factors that influence cost, including the size and species of the tree, its condition, location, and accessibility.
Many smaller or more straightforward removals can be completed in can be removed, chipped, and hauled away in 3-6 hours, while larger or more complex removals may take a day or two.
Either way, we’ll provide you with a clear timeframe for your specific project so you know what to expect before work begins.
